Laboratory Facility for Measurement of Hot Gaseous Plume Radiative Transfer.
Abstract
This report describes a facility at the Atmospheric Sciences Laboratory (ASL) for the measurement of hot gaseous plum radiative transfer in the atmosphere. The measurement sequence, by using a Fourier transform spectrometer (FTS), required to extract the hot-through-cold radiance, the source radiance, the hot cell absorption, and the long path cell transmission is detailed. Problems peculiar to hot gaseous radiative transfer measurements are addressed as well as the impact on military systems. The direction of upcoming measurements to be performed with this unique ASL facility is also described. (Author)
